Output 17543301613e23e64c7c5ebe5fdadac911d417afb3ee509171afb05579eccd10:108

value
1023405
script pubkey
OP_0 OP_PUSHBYTES_20 64e0320d652be84ae0e6b3c77ef7dd7e0b5f86b0
address
bc1qvnsryrt9905y4c8xk0rhaa7a0c94lp4sz4u06r
transaction
17543301613e23e64c7c5ebe5fdadac911d417afb3ee509171afb05579eccd10